Roadside assistance and emergency towing services are available 24/7 in the Detroit metropolitan region from D&H Towing & Services, guaranteeing prompt and reliable assistance. Their knowledgeable staff is committed to maintaining safety regulations while providing outstanding customer service.
1 Posts
1 Photos
0 Videos
Lives in Merced
From 2499 E Gerard Ave #26, Merced, CA 95341, United States